In the late summer of 2014, the life of a young man was tragically cut short on the streets of Memphis, Tennessee. Clarence Calhoun, a 20-year-old African-American male, was shot and killed on August 17, 2014. His death added to a concerning increase in homicides that plagued the city that year, a grim trend that left many families grappling with unanswered questions and the pain of sudden loss.
The investigation into Clarence's murder was met with significant challenges from the outset.
